A leading Central Government Organisation are seeking a Digital Java Development Lead for a 12-month contract. SC Clearance will be supported.

As a Technical Lead, you will:

  • Set direction for your service/capability and your team that is in line with overarching strategy.
  • Ensure that your teams work aligns to standards.
  • Have a clear focus on delivering quality, assured and secure services.
  • Ensure that your team follows best practice.
  • Be aware of and assess the impact of any change that you are making.
  • Have an outward facing viewpoint, understanding where your team and products fit into the bigger picture.

Essential Skills

  • Significant demonstrable experience in one or both of:
    • Modern software engineering for digital products (ideally Java, microservice architectures, Hexagonal software architecture, Mongo and Kafka);
    • OR designing and implementing modern cloud infrastructure, DevOps, and automation (ideally AWS, Terraform, GitLab CI, Jenkins);
  • Significant demonstrable experience of leading engineering teams providing technical leadership and guidance, and coaching and mentoring to support team member development opportunities.
